Concrete flatwork services involve the installation, repair, and maintenance of flat concrete surfaces such as driveways, sidewalks, patios, and flooring. These projects typically require preparing the ground, pouring the concrete, and finishing the surface to ensure durability and a smooth appearance. Skilled contractors use various techniques to achieve a level, even surface that can withstand daily use and exposure to the elements. Whether building a new patio or restoring an existing driveway, professional flatwork services help create functional and attractive outdoor and indoor surfaces.

This service is essential for addressing common problems like cracks, uneven surfaces, and deterioration caused by weather, heavy use, or poor initial installation. Over time, concrete can develop cracks or become uneven, creating tripping hazards or reducing the aesthetic appeal of a property. Flatwork specialists can perform repairs such as crack filling, leveling, or resurfacing to restore the surface’s integrity. Proper maintenance and timely repairs can extend the lifespan of concrete surfaces and prevent more costly replacements in the future.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Flatwork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Small Repairs - Typical costs for minor concrete flatwork repairs, such as patching cracks or small surface fixes,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of the spectrum.

Driveways and Walkways - Installing or replacing a standard driveway or walkway usually costs between $1,500 and $4,000. Larger or more intricate designs can push costs beyond this range, but most projects are completed within the middle tiers.

Commercial Flatwork - Commercial concrete flatwork projects often range from $3,000 to $10,000 depending on size and complexity. Many jobs land in the lower to middle part of this range, while larger, more detailed projects can exceed $10,000.

Full Flatwork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of existing flatwork can typically cost from $4,000 to $15,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ects tend to fall into the higher end of this range, with smaller jobs often staying below $6,000.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of flatwork services do local contractors provide? Local contractors typically offer services such as concrete driveway installation, sidewalk pouring, patio slabs, and flooring for garages or basements.

How can I ensure the quality of concrete flatwork from local service providers? To assess quality, consider reviewing portfolios, checking references, and confirming that contractors use quality materials and proper installation techniques.

Are there different finishes available for concrete flatwork projects? Yes, local contractors can provide various finishes including smooth, broomed, stamped, or exposed aggregate to match aesthetic preferences.

What factors should be considered when planning concrete flatwork installation? Important factors include site preparation, drainage considerations, thickness requirements, and compatibility with surrounding structures.

How do local service providers handle concrete flatwork repairs or replacements? Contractors assess the existing surface, remove damaged sections if needed, and replace or repair the concrete to restore its functionality and appearance.
